1. Global Basalt Fiber Market Trends & The Commercial Landscape

Continuous Basalt Fiber (CBF) is rapidly transitions from a specialty niche composite to a cornerstone material in modern green engineering and Industry 4.0 infrastructure projects. As global industries seek alternatives to traditional glass fiber (which lacks sufficient chemical resistance) and carbon fiber (which remains cost-prohibitive for large-scale structural integration), basalt fiber occupies the optimal "sweet spot." It offers high tensile strength (ranging from 3000 to 4800 MPa), exceptional thermal stability (-260°C to +820°C), and native immunity to alkaline and acidic erosion without requiring expensive polymer coatings.

In 2025, the demand for CBF is driven primarily by national infrastructure initiatives, environmental mandates, and industrial modernization. The transition toward circular economy targets has forced civil engineering departments to evaluate the lifecycle impact of their structural components. Basalt fiber is manufactured from raw basalt rock through a single-constituent melting process that requires no hazardous chemical additives. This yields a carbon footprint that is up to 80% lower than carbon fiber and significantly cleaner than glass fiber production. Consequently, multi-national engineering firms are standardizing on basalt reinforcements for projects where long-term durability and carbon-offset accounting are crucial metrics.

Expert Insights: Information Gain on Raw Material Sourcing

Unlike glass fiber, which relies on a complex mixture of silica sand, kaolin, limestone, and colemanite, continuous basalt fiber utilizes exclusively raw volcanic rock. The quality and structural limits of the resulting fiber are determined directly by the geochemical profile of the basalt quarry. Specifically, the ratio of silicon dioxide (SiO₂) and aluminum oxide (Al₂O₃) dictates the ultimate tensile capability, while iron oxide content (FeO and Fe₂O₃) determines the thermal insulation limits. 2. China Industry 4.0: Supply Chain Resilience, Efficiency & Tech Superiority

The manufacturing of high-quality continuous basalt fiber requires highly precise control over furnace temperatures. China Beihai, established in 2015 in Jiujiang, Jiangxi Province, has pioneered the integration of Industry 4.0 principles to address this challenge. Traditional manufacturing relies on fossil fuel-fired furnaces, which frequently suffer from temperature fluctuations that introduce structural micro-cracks in the drawn filaments. China Beihai’s facility employs next-generation, computer-controlled modular electric furnaces.

These modern furnaces maintain an ultra-stable molten basalt temperature profile at precisely 1450°C. Real-time optical monitoring systems continuously measure the diameter of the output filaments as they exit the platinum-rhodium alloy bushing plates. By adjusting drawing speeds programmatically, the system guarantees a uniform filament distribution. This high level of technical control reduces tensile strength variance to less than 2.1%, giving design engineers confidence that safety margins will be maintained under extreme loads.

3. Global Procurement Trends & Dynamic Buying Intentions

B2B procurement departments have transitioned from evaluating raw material cost-per-kilogram to a Total Cost of Ownership (TCO) model. In fields like coastal civil engineering, traditional steel reinforcement is prone to rapid degradation from chloride exposure. This leads to costly maintenance interventions within 15 to 20 years. Basalt Fiber Rebar offers an alternative that is completely rust-proof, has a tensile strength three times greater than steel, and is only one-quarter the weight.

This weight reduction translates to lower inland transportation and handling costs at construction sites. Because basalt is naturally non-conductive and electromagnetically transparent, it is also highly suited for hospital MRI rooms, toll booths, and telecommunication centers where steel reinforcement would cause electromagnetic interference. By focusing on these specific physical advantages, procurement officers can justify the initial material investment and realize substantial savings over the operational lifetime of the infrastructure.

Industrial Product Properties & Comparison Matrix

Material Category Tensile Strength (MPa) Elastic Modulus (GPa) Thermal Range (°C) Primary Industrial Applications
Continuous Basalt Roving 3000 – 4800 85 – 95 -260 to +820 Filament winding, pultrusion profiles, marine hull reinforcements
Basalt Fiber Rebar 1100 – 1400 50 – 55 -100 to +300 Marine seawalls, bridge decks, chemical facility foundations
Basalt Needled felt/Mat N/A (Non-woven) N/A -260 to +700 Automotive engine heat shields, industrial kiln insulations
Basalt Fireproof Fabric 2000 – 3200 75 – 85 -260 to +650 Thermal insulation curtains, high-temp protective apparel
Alkali-Resistant Mesh ≥ 3000 80 – 90 -150 to +400 Exterior insulation finishing systems (EIFS), plaster reinforcement

4. Understanding the China Basalt Pricelist & Key Cost Drivers

When analyzing a China Basalt Pricelist, procurement managers must understand that prices are not static. They vary based on several key technical factors:

  • Filament Diameter (Microns): Finer filaments (e.g., 7μm to 9μm) require slower drawing speeds and higher energy inputs, resulting in a higher cost per ton. Larger filaments (13μm to 22μm) are more economical and are widely used in geogrids and concrete reinforcements.
  • Sizing Chemistry: The chemical emulsion applied to the fiber surface dictates how effectively it binds to matrix resins. Specialized silane coupling agents engineered for epoxy, vinyl ester, or phenolic matrices add a premium to the base price but are critical to preventing delamination in corrosive environments.
  • Tex Rating (Linear Density): Lower Tex rovings (e.g., 300 Tex) are more complex to manufacture and wind, making them more expensive than higher Tex rovings (e.g., 2400 Tex or 4800 Tex).
  • Logistical Volume & Package Formats: Bulk shipments of standardized direct rovings on standard pallets offer the lowest cost per metric ton. Custom packaging, such as cut-to-length chopped strands, requires additional post-processing steps.

Continuous Basalt Fiber Roving

Continuous Basalt Fiber Roving serves as the primary building block for the composites industry. It is manufactured by drawing molten basalt rock through platinum-rhodium bushings, yielding high-performance filaments that are gathered into a single strand.

This material features high chemical resistance, excellent dielectric properties, and high tensile strength. It is highly suited for filament winding (for high-pressure LPG and gas cylinders), pultrusion (for structural beams and profiles), and weaving into technical fabrics.

Basalt Fiber Rebar for Concrete Reinforcement

Basalt Fiber Rebar is an alternative to traditional steel reinforcement. Composed of high-strength continuous basalt fibers bound together by a corrosion-resistant vinyl ester resin matrix, it offers key structural advantages.

It is immune to rust and chloride attack, making it highly suited for concrete structures exposed to marine environments, bridge decks, highway barriers, and chemical storage facilities.

At one-quarter the weight of steel, basalt rebar simplifies onsite handling and reduces labor and transportation costs. Its coefficient of thermal expansion is also closely matched to concrete, minimizing internal stress and crack propagation.

How does basalt fiber compare to glass and carbon fiber?

Basalt fiber offers high performance at a competitive price. It delivers significantly greater chemical and acid-alkali resistance than standard glass fiber, along with an operating temperature limit up to 820°C. While carbon fiber offers higher absolute stiffness, basalt fiber provides a cost-effective alternative with superior impact tolerance and a lower carbon footprint.
